    • Influence of lock-stitching technology on formation of flexible guided three-dimensional fabric loops

    • The research progress in the field of 3D fabric forming was introduced, and experts explored the residual tensile strength damage law of flexible guided 3D fabric yarn locking coils. A predictive model for the relationship between yarn pulling force and coil residual tensile strength was established, providing data support for achieving efficient and high-quality yarn locking in 3D fabric forming.
